Understanding the Duty of a Security Specialist
In today’s hectic and risk-prone company environment, the role of a safety consultant is a lot more critical than ever before. Organizations throughout numerous industries are progressively recognizing the significance of work environment safety and security and conformity with guidelines, which has led to a higher demand for professionals devoted to this area. A security expert helps businesses reduce risks, advertise best techniques, and ensure their procedures adhere to local and national security requirements.
A security specialist’s primary responsibility is to analyze office settings to determine possible hazards that can place employees at risk. This includes performing complete inspections, evaluating safety and security procedures, and evaluating mishap reports to identify areas of improvement. By employing their expertise, security professionals can aid companies establish customized security strategies that not just abide by regulations yet additionally foster a culture of security within the workplace.
Moreover, security specialists play a vital duty in training and informing employees regarding safety protocols and ideal techniques. They develop training programs and products that involve personnel in understanding the importance of workplace security and compliance. This proactive strategy not just aids to decrease the possibility of mishaps but empowers workers to take ownership of their security which of their colleagues.
Along with developing a secure work environment, safety and security consultants also help companies in navigating the complicated world of legal responsibilities and sector laws. They remain educated regarding the most up to date modifications in security regulations, making certain that businesses remain compliant and prevent potential lawful effects. By giving experienced advice and continuous support, safety specialists can help firms save money and sources in the future by protecting against crashes and penalties connected to safety and security offenses.
